css樣式動(dòng)態(tài)命名 css怎么做動(dòng)態(tài)效果

css命名規(guī)則

1、連字符CSS選擇器命名規(guī)范1).長(zhǎng)名稱或詞組可以使用中橫線來(lái)為選擇器命名。

自貢網(wǎng)站制作公司哪家好,找成都創(chuàng)新互聯(lián)!從網(wǎng)頁(yè)設(shè)計(jì)、網(wǎng)站建設(shè)、微信開(kāi)發(fā)、APP開(kāi)發(fā)、響應(yīng)式網(wǎng)站建設(shè)等網(wǎng)站項(xiàng)目制作,到程序開(kāi)發(fā),運(yùn)營(yíng)維護(hù)。成都創(chuàng)新互聯(lián)成立于2013年到現(xiàn)在10年的時(shí)間,我們擁有了豐富的建站經(jīng)驗(yàn)和運(yùn)維經(jīng)驗(yàn),來(lái)保證我們的工作的順利進(jìn)行。專(zhuān)注于網(wǎng)站建設(shè)就選成都創(chuàng)新互聯(lián)。

2、至此,我們的class命名方法討論完畢,說(shuō)到底就是先記住一些必備的基礎(chǔ)關(guān)鍵詞,然后合理應(yīng)用上剛才提出的修飾關(guān)鍵詞,特殊化class,層級(jí)及最后的樣式范圍就可以了。

3、id: id是設(shè)置標(biāo)簽的標(biāo)識(shí)。用于定義一個(gè)元素的獨(dú)特的樣式。在CSS樣式定義的時(shí)候 以“#”來(lái)開(kāi)頭命名id名稱。

4、對(duì)于CSS樣式的命名規(guī)則,建議用字母、_號(hào)工、-號(hào)、數(shù)字組成,必須以字母開(kāi)頭,不能為純數(shù)字,為了開(kāi)發(fā)后樣式名管理方便,大家請(qǐng)用有意義的單詞或縮寫(xiě)組合來(lái)命名,讓同事一看就明白這樣式大概是哪一塊的,這樣就節(jié)省了查找樣式的時(shí)間。

5、DIV+CSS樣式表命名不能隨意而為,否則以后進(jìn)行維護(hù)時(shí)困難很大。如同軟件開(kāi)發(fā)中對(duì)類(lèi)名的仔細(xì)處理一樣,DIV+CSS樣式表命名也需要遵循規(guī)則。

css命名規(guī)范

1、第二是如果要修改樣式的時(shí)候得修改html文件,而不是css樣式,而純靜態(tài)的頁(yè)面是很少的,所以如果是前后端分離的,由php或后端語(yǔ)言渲染頁(yè)面的話,改個(gè)樣式還要通知后端同事去修改文件,那估計(jì)人家得瘋掉。

2、正確命名規(guī)則如下:名稱不能以數(shù)字開(kāi)始,只能以字母、連字符、下劃線開(kāi)始。之后可以是字母、連字符、下劃線或數(shù)字。同時(shí)應(yīng)該注意的是,CSS中的命名是區(qū)分大小寫(xiě)。

3、BEM(塊元素修飾符)BEM是一個(gè)名為命名約定的CSS。它不涉及如何編寫(xiě)CSS的結(jié)構(gòu)。在進(jìn)行電腦培訓(xùn)的過(guò)程中,電腦培訓(xùn)建議僅為每個(gè)元素添加具有以下內(nèi)容的CSS類(lèi)名稱。

4、現(xiàn)在我是不抱有任何幻想,關(guān)于說(shuō)BEM是一個(gè)很好的CSS命名規(guī)范。因?yàn)樗^對(duì)不是!我曾經(jīng)很長(zhǎng)一段時(shí)間因?yàn)樗舐恼Z(yǔ)法規(guī)范而放棄了它。作為設(shè)計(jì)者的我不希望我的標(biāo)記中出現(xiàn)丑陋的雙下劃線以及連字符。

5、css樣式的類(lèi)名或者相關(guān)的ID名也是需要一定的規(guī)則,這樣有利于前臺(tái)和后臺(tái)的交互。一般公司開(kāi)發(fā)都是給技術(shù)員一本網(wǎng)站前端開(kāi)發(fā)規(guī)范,里面詳細(xì)的說(shuō)明了各個(gè)命名的規(guī)則等相關(guān)的問(wèn)題。

如何命名CSS文件及樣式規(guī)范更利于SEO優(yōu)化

1、規(guī)范內(nèi)容頁(yè)面位置 一般來(lái)講,搜索引擎的蜘蛛爬行的順序?yàn)椋簭淖蟮接遥瑥纳系较?,利用CSS樣式,我們可以很好的分配重要資源在相關(guān)位置:① 頂部導(dǎo)航包含核心關(guān)鍵詞鏈接:從左到右,關(guān)鍵詞指數(shù)依次遞減。

2、網(wǎng)頁(yè)標(biāo)題要一起且不重復(fù) 每個(gè)網(wǎng)頁(yè)制作都要有自己一起的標(biāo)題,即便在一個(gè)網(wǎng)站內(nèi),主題相同,不同頁(yè)面具體內(nèi)容不會(huì)相同,網(wǎng)頁(yè)標(biāo)題也不能重復(fù)。

3、Css的引入:Css的引入一般有兩種,link和@import,一般建議使用link引入。這樣可以避免考慮@import的語(yǔ)法規(guī)則和注意事項(xiàng),避免產(chǎn)生資源文件下載順序混亂和http請(qǐng)求過(guò)多的煩惱。

4、利于搜索引擎的抓取并且可以加快網(wǎng)頁(yè)的加載速度。

怎么給CSS命名

把id留給后臺(tái)開(kāi)發(fā)和JS使用,除此之外頁(yè)面的page id(如首頁(yè)的外層需要一個(gè)ID id=pageIndex),頁(yè)面結(jié)構(gòu)(header main footer)允許用id命名(ID命名建議使用駝峰命名)。其他禁止id使用在樣式表CSS命名中,一律使用class命名。

長(zhǎng)名稱或詞組可以使用中橫線來(lái)為選擇器命名。

ctrl+f 查找和替換 如圖 替換完,再去改網(wǎng)站文件夾里改css.css的文件名 清理緩存,刷新就齊活了。

如何動(dòng)態(tài)設(shè)置CSS樣式

1、例如,以下代碼將選擇類(lèi)名為“blue”的所有div元素:`javascriptdselectAll(div.blue)`添加CSS樣式在選擇元素后,可以使用D3中的style()方法添加CSS樣式。該方法接受兩個(gè)參數(shù):要設(shè)置的樣式屬性和屬性值。

2、改變className,但首先在樣式表中預(yù)設(shè)定樣式類(lèi)。例如:document.getElementById(obj).className=...改變cssText。

3、準(zhǔn)備多組CSS,比如:.button1{ /*style1*/ } .button2{ /*style2*/ } 在用JavaScript修改Button的class,把button1改成button2,就實(shí)現(xiàn)了指向的CSS樣式改變。

4、引入jquery 然后給你要設(shè)置動(dòng)畫(huà)的對(duì)象增加或者刪除css3動(dòng)畫(huà)的類(lèi)就可以了。

5、JavaScript設(shè)置外部樣式 當(dāng)你需要改變的樣式已經(jīng)在css文件中定義了,我們也可以用JavaScript直接用定義好的css樣式。

6、});});.intro1{font-size:120%;color:red;}.intro2{color:blue;} This is a paragraph. 添加了兩個(gè)class樣式,后面的樣式覆蓋了之前的。所以字體顯示是藍(lán)色的。

文章標(biāo)題:css樣式動(dòng)態(tài)命名 css怎么做動(dòng)態(tài)效果
新聞來(lái)源:http://muchs.cn/article23/dgdsijs.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供用戶體驗(yàn)手機(jī)網(wǎng)站建設(shè)、網(wǎng)站策劃、Google、定制網(wǎng)站、靜態(tài)網(wǎng)站

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

成都網(wǎng)頁(yè)設(shè)計(jì)公司